To calculate the area of a rectangle, you need to multiply its length by its width. The formula for the area of a rectangle is:
Area = Length × Width
Here are the steps to solve for the area of a rectangle:
1. **Identify the Length and Width:** Measure or determine the length and width of the rectangle. The length is usually the longer side, and the width is the shorter side.
2. **Plug into the Formula:** Once you have the length and width values, plug them into the formula: Area = Length × Width.
3. **Perform the Multiplication:** Multiply the length by the width to calculate the area.
4. **Units:** Remember to include units for the measurements you used (e.g., square units such as square inches, square feet, square meters) in your final answer to indicate that you are referring to an area.
Here's an example:
Suppose you have a rectangle with a length of 10 units and a width of 5 units.
Area = Length × Width
Area = 10 units × 5 units
Area = 50 square units
So, the area of the rectangle is 50 square units.
Keep in mind that the units for length and width should be the same in order for the area to be correctly represented in square units.
